The Thermo-Electrical System of Medicine or The Science of Life, Health and Disease by Charles Searle is a comprehensive guide to the principles of medicine, health and disease. The book delves into the relationship between heat and electricity in the human body, exploring how these two fundamental forces interact to create and maintain health.Searle's work is based on the premise that the human body is a complex system of electrical and thermal processes, and that understanding these processes is key to diagnosing and treating disease. He explores the role of temperature, energy, and electrical currents in the body, and how these factors can be manipulated to promote health and healing.The book covers a wide range of topics, including the principles of thermoelectricity, the physiology of the human body, the causes and symptoms of disease, and the various methods of treatment available. Searle also discusses the importance of diet and lifestyle in maintaining health, and provides practical advice on how to achieve optimal health through natural means.Overall, The Thermo-Electrical System of Medicine is a fascinating and insightful exploration of the science of health and disease. It offers a unique perspective on the human body and its workings, and provides valuable information for anyone interested in understanding the principles of medicine and health.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
